Dune of Pilat

44.6611°N, 1.1666°W

The Dune of Pilat is the highest sand dune in Europe, rising to nearly 106 meters. Located at the entrance to the Arcachon Basin, it offers an exceptional panorama contrasting the immensity of the Atlantic Ocean with the dense green mantle of the Landes pine forest.

Cabanes Tchanquées (Stilt Cabins)

44.6611°N, 1.1666°W

Emblematic symbols of the basin, the 'cabanes tchanquées' are wooden cabins perched on stilts in the middle of the water, near Bird Island. Once used to guard oyster beds, they bear witness to the region's unique oyster-farming heritage.

Winter Town

44.6611°N, 1.1666°W

Arcachon's Winter Town is a picturesque district that houses a sumptuous collection of 19th-century villas. Featuring whimsical architecture ranging from Swiss chalets and Moorish manors to Gothic mansions, they embody the lavish seaside development of the era.
